Verified Career Highlights and Public Recognition
Laverne Cox rose to prominence through Orange Is the New Black, earning a place among the first transgender actors to receive Emmy recognition. Her public profile grew through interviews, advocacy campaigns, and high-profile events, including film premieres and awards shows. Media attention has consistently emphasized her leadership in trans advocacy and her influence on entertainment industry conversations.
| Attribute | Verified Detail | Source Type |
|---|---|---|
| Notable Role | Sophia Burset on Orange Is the New Black | Series credits and official show materials |
| Emmy Recognition | Primetime Emmy nomination for Outstanding Supporting Actress in a Drama Series | Academy of Television Arts & Sciences records |
| Major Red Carpet Venues | Premieres, awards shows, and inclusive fashion events | Event schedules and verified media archives |
| Advocacy Focus | Transgender rights, racial justice, and body positivity | Public statements and partnered campaign materials |
